Output 0aa985b0d8fbddac61764002ad0ea2d21e80ef1782826f9c8753ff5fcdb9664a:3

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e272399ed0ca32e01c0274944371905c83b2efe OP_EQUAL
address
3EeemDML5RDhfQsC2iBk99TcF8ksuLLDWe
transaction
0aa985b0d8fbddac61764002ad0ea2d21e80ef1782826f9c8753ff5fcdb9664a
confirmations
355235
spent
true